Police arrest 2 Ghanaians,2 Guineans over Jamestown van attack in Kyebi

Police arrest 2 Ghanaians,2 Guineans over Jamestown van attack in Kyebi

Police have arrested four persons, including two Guineans in the Eastern region in connection to the deadly bullion van attack which saw the demise of a police officer.

It could be recalled on Monday 14th June 2021 that General Constable Emmanuel Osei lost his life after unknown men attacked the bullion van he escorted to the bank at Jamestown.

The robbery also witnessed the demise of a lady who called for help when the unknown attacked the Bullion van.

Latest development pertaining to the Jamestown Bullion van robbery indicate that the police have arrested the four suspects in Kyebi in the Abuakwa South Municipality in the Eastern Region of Ghana.

The suspects are Collins Addae aka Kekye, Ebenezer Gyimah aka Peace, and Musa Kamara with his brother Suleman Ketah both from Guinea.

The Police disclosed that Kamara has been on the wanted list.
